Gabriel Yomi Dabiri
Gabriel Yomi Dabiri is a finance attorney based in New York who advises clients on a broad range of complex financing matters in domestic and cross-border settings. He serves as the Global Head of Private Credit and Direct Lending at his firm, where he works closely with lenders, sponsors, and corporate borrowers. His practice covers special situations, debt restructurings, and bankruptcy-related transactions, with regular involvement in senior, mezzanine, subordinated, and unitranche facilities. He also advises on first- and second-lien structures. His approach is grounded in careful analysis and practical execution, with a focus on helping clients reach workable outcomes that align with their commercial priorities. Gabriel has built significant experience across many segments of private credit and direct lending, including cash flow lending, asset-based lending, subscription lines, distressed debt, debtor-in-possession financing, and real estate finance structures. His background includes extensive work on buy-and-hold private credit strategies and on broadly syndicated finance transactions. This combination allows him to support both routine financings and highly structured matters. He regularly negotiates intercreditor and subordination arrangements and advises on sensitive restructuring situations. His work reflects a balanced perspective that considers legal requirements alongside market conditions, enabling clients to move forward with a clear understanding of risks and obligations. Gabriel Yomi Dabiri brings a global outlook to his practice through dual qualification and long-term international experience. He is admitted to practice law in New York and in England and Wales, and he has lived and worked across major financial centers in North America, Europe, and Asia. He divides his professional time among these regions, which has shaped his understanding of cross-border finance and multi-jurisdictional transactions.
